Additionally, similar to LATE-PCR ... SpletUse DNA polymerases with high processivity for robust amplification even with short extension times. Suboptimal number of PCR cycles: Adjust the number of cycles (generally to 25–35 cycles) to produce an adequate yield of PCR products. Extend the number of cycles to 40 if DNA input is fewer than 10 copies.
